Senior Software Engineer - Java + Angular + Oracle
About the Role
We are seeking a talented Senior Software Engineer (Java + Angular + Oracle) to join our dynamic team at Software Mind. This remote position offers you the opportunity to work on transformative projects with tech giants and unicorns. You will be part of a cross-functional engineering team that values creativity and ownership in every project.
What You'll Do
- Design, develop, and maintain scalable web applications using Java and Angular.
- Build and optimize RESTful APIs and backend services.
- Develop and manage database objects, queries, and performance tuning in Oracle.
- Collaborate with cross-functional teams for requirement analysis and solution design.
- Write clean, reusable, and testable code following best practices.
- Troubleshoot, debug, and resolve production issues.
- Participate in code reviews and continuous improvement initiatives.
Requirements
- 5+ years of hands-on experience in Java development.
- Strong experience with Angular (2+).
- Solid experience with Oracle SQL/PLSQL and database design.
- Good understanding of OOP, design patterns, and microservices architecture.
- Familiarity with version control tools (Git) and CI/CD processes.
- Strong problem-solving skills and ability to learn quickly.
Nice to Have
- Experience or working knowledge of Microsoft Azure.
- Exposure to containerization and cloud-native development is an advantage.
What We Offer
- Flexible employment and remote work opportunities.
- International projects with leading global clients.
- Non-corporate atmosphere that fosters creativity.
- Language classes and internal & external training.
- Private healthcare and insurance.
- Multisport card and well-being initiatives.
This Senior Software Engineer role at Software Mind offers a unique opportunity to work remotely on exciting international projects with a flexible work environment.
About Software Mind
Explore exciting career opportunities at Software Mind in 2026. Discover a range of remote, hybrid, and office roles tailored to your skills. Utilize our advanced filters to find the perfect job match, track your application progress, and gain valuable company insights. Join us and take the next step in your career with Software Mind, where innovation meets opportunity in the tech industry.
Who Will Succeed Here
Proficient in Java and Angular frameworks, with a strong grasp of building RESTful APIs and microservices architectures, ensuring high performance and reliability in web applications.
Self-motivated and disciplined, thriving in a remote work environment with the ability to manage time effectively and maintain productivity while collaborating across time zones.
Demonstrated experience with CI/CD pipelines, particularly in Azure DevOps, showcasing a mindset focused on continuous integration and deployment best practices.
Learning Resources
Career Path
Market Overview
Skills & Requirements
Domain Trends
Industry News
Loading latest industry news...
Finding relevant articles from the last 6 months